Format: Trade Paperback, 296 pages Date Published: August 2008 ISBN: 9781400007226 Series: Full-Color Gold Guides

Fodor’s O’ahu, 2nd Edition features options for a variety of budgets, interests, and tastes, so you make the choices to plan your trip of a lifetime.

•If it’s not worth your time, it’s not in this book. Fodor’s discriminating ratings, including our top tier Fodor’s Choice designations, ensure that you’ll know about the most interesting and enjoyable places in O’ahu.

Experience O’ahu like a local! Fodor’s O’ahu, 2nd Edition includes unique photo-features that impart the island’s culture, covering Pearl Harbor, lively Waikiki, the famous surfing beaches of the North Shore, and much more!

•Indispensable, customized trip planning tools include “Top Reasons to Go,” “Word of Mouth” advice from other travelers, and tips to help save money, bypass lines, and avoid common travel pitfalls.

•Full-color pullout map.
